Power Amplifier Designer - GaN
Italy, onsite working required
We are seeking an experienced GaN Power Amplifier Designer to drive the development of next-generation communication systems. In this role, you will design, optimize, and validate high-power, high-efficiency GaN amplifiers for applications spanning cellular networks, base stations, and satellite communications. You will be part of a multidisciplinary research team working on advanced technologies in microwave and millimeter-wave domains, contributing to cutting-edge innovation in wireless systems.
Key Responsibilities:- Design, simulate, and optimize GaN-based power amplifiers.
- Conduct research into emerging GaN technologies, device methodologies, and materials.
- Perform chip-level trade-off studies considering link budget, die size, and modulation schemes.
- Develop and execute lab and field test plans to validate system performance.
- Troubleshoot design and system issues to ensure reliability and performance.
- Stay up-to-date with GaN PA advances and contribute through publications, conferences, or patents.
Required:
- Master’s degree or Ph.D. in Microwave Engineering, Physics, or related field.
- Proven experience in GaN power amplifier design and analysis.
- Proficiency with industry-standard simulation tools (e.g., ADS, HFSS, Cadence).
- Strong understanding of transistor-level specifications and failure mechanisms.
- Hands-on experience with chip testing, performance validation, and troubleshooting.
- In-depth knowledge of RF PA theory, electromagnetic fields, and wireless communication protocols.
- Ability to work independently as well as in cross-functional teams.
- Excellent written and verbal communication skills.
- Experience with product-level GaN PA design.
- Published research or patents in GaN power amplifier technologies.
